WebFrank Beken Biography. When Cowes chemist Alfred Beken (1855 – 1915) first sought to experiment with marine photography, the art was in its infancy. While early attempts provided inconsistent quality, undeterred by a myriad of technical problems of photographing at sea, Frank Beken (1880 – 1970) designed and built a new style of camera. WebZebedee is Cowes Sailability Club’s patrol and safety boat. She is a rigid inflatable boat (RIB) capable of high speed and used to ensure the safety of our boats and crews.
